Involvement of Iba1 in membrane ruffling and phagocytosis of macrophages/microglia.
Journal of cell science - 1 Sept 2000
Ohsawa K, Imai Y, Kanazawa H, Sasaki Y, Kohsaka S
Abstract excerpt
Ionized calcium binding adaptor molecule 1, Iba1, is an EF hand calcium binding protein whose expression is restricted to macrophages/microglia. In this study, Iba1 was shown to colocalize with F-actin in membrane ruffles induced by macrophage colony-stimulating factor and in phagocytic cups formed during zymosan phagocytosis.
